2015 Ford F-150 Horsepower, Towing Numbers Confirmed

Jul 24, 2014 12:19 PM EDT | Matt Mercuro

Ford has released the official towing and horsepower numbers on the two new engines in the full redesigned 2015 Ford F-150 pickup truck lineup.

Pricing for the Ford F-150 has not been announced yet by the automaker.

Standard equipment found in the 2015 F-150 includes the aspirated 3.5-liter V6 engine, which delivers 283 horsepower and 255 lb.-ft. of torque.

In comparison, the 3.7-liter V6 engine in the 2014 F-150 delivers 302 hp and 278 lb.-ft. of torque.

The 3.5-liter EcoBoost V6 found in the 2014 F-150 is capable of delivering 365 hp and 420 lb.-ft. of torque.

Interested customers can expect the new 2.7-liter EcoBoost V6 engine with standard automatic stop-start delivers 325 hp and 375 lb.-ft. of torque, according to the automaker.

Ford hasn't provided fuel economy estimates on the engines yet. The EPA hasn't posted any information regarding the new engines either.

Ford hasn't provided performance numbers for the 5.0-liter V8 and a 3.5-liter twin-turbocharged V6 engines in the 2015 F-150 lineup.

The 2.7-liter EcoBoost V6 engine is capable of towing up to 8,500 pounds, according to the automaker.

Ford's standard 3.5-liter V6 engine is capable of towing up to 7,600 pounds.

The new vehicle will reach U.S. dealerships during the fourth quarter of 2014.

Ford expects the 2015 F-150 to compete with the 2015 Chevrolet Silverado, Toyota Tacoma, and the Ram 1500.
